Subject: Inkwell markdown pipeline 5.1 deployed

On-call: the Inkwell rendering pipeline is now on 5.1 in production. Changes: sanitizer runs before the table parser, footnote rendering is cached per document, and the fallback plain-text path no longer strips headings. If render latency alarms fire, roll back via the standard script — it handles cache invalidation. Known issue: nested blockquotes over six levels render flat. The deployment trace token follows.

build token for hawep-kageg: htk14_558814e2114cc7

Ticket: Staging env misconfigured for Siftgate bloom filter

The bloom layer in front of the Pellet KV store is rejecting all lookups in staging because the env file was copied from the dev template without credentials. False-positive tuning values are fine; only the auth line is missing. To unblock the weekly demo, the Pellet admission secret must be set on the following line.

env line for yaguf-fajop: LEDGER_TOKEN13=fb08984397349

**Mgmt Meeting Minutes — Retiring the Brightline Range**

Quick recap for sales leads at Fenholt Supplies: we agreed to retire the Brightline fixture range by year-end. Remaining stock moves to clearance pricing next month, and accounts on standing orders get migrated to the Lumetta range. Trade-in incentives were approved in principle. The confidential note on next steps sits just below.

board note of bajof-bajeg: The pricing group signed off on a budget of $13.4 million for Project Sildor. The renewal with Lamixek Holdings closes at $48.9 million a year, 49 percent above the last contract.

- Added per-allocation GPU memory tracking with stack capture; opt in via the profiler config flag.
- Plugin hooks now receive pool fragmentation stats on each sampling tick.
- Breaking: the legacy snapshot format is removed; migrate exports to the v2 schema before upgrading.
- Fixed double-counted transfers on multi-device setups.
- Overhead reduced to roughly 3% at default sampling rates.

Plugin authors should validate against the 2.8 preview build before release week. Report tooling regressions to the maintainer named below.

approver of yajef-fajef = Oliwyn Silion Kasok Kasox